Grasping Roll Off Dumpster Dimensions
Knowing the dimensions of a roll off dumpster is vital before you rent one. These containers come in numerous sizes, and choosing the inadequate size can result problems like going beyond limits or not making full use. A standard roll off dumpster comes in different sizes, often categorized by volume.
To select the appropriate size, consider the amount of trash you expect to have.
Let's look at some typical roll off dumpster dimensions:
* 10 cubic yard
* 20 cubic yard
* 30 cubic yard
* 40 cubic yard
Remember to also factor in the height of the dumpster, as this can influence what you can put inside.

Picking the Right Roll Off Dumpster Size for Your Project
Deciding on the suitable roll off dumpster size for your task can seem like a daunting endeavor. However, with a little planning, you can effectively determine the best size to hold your debris. A overly small dumpster can lead to excessive waste, check here while a too large one can be pricey and impractical.
To ensure you pick the right size, initially evaluating the amount of debris your project will create. Consider the varieties of materials you'll be getting rid of, as some items, like renovation debris, can be significantly bulky than others.
Once you have a approximate understanding of the volume of waste, you can consult size diagrams provided by dumpster providers. These charts will typically list the sizes of different dumpster sizes and the matching weight limits.
Ultimately, remember that it's always wiser to tend on the direction of a somewhat larger dumpster than you think you'll need. This will avoid overflow and guarantee that your project runs efficiently.

Navigating Roll Off Dumpster Rental Costs
When it comes to managing your next demolition or major renovation project, a roll off dumpster can be an crucial tool. However, navigating the varied world of rental costs can sometimes feel like trudging through a thick forest. Many factors can affect the final figure, so it's necessary to be aware of them before.
First, the dimensions of the dumpster you choose will have a substantial impact on the cost. More spacious dumpsters can accommodate more materials, which generally results in a higher rental fee. Similarly, the duration of your rental will have a role into the overall cost.
Finally, remember that open communication is key when dealing with dumpster rental companies. Don't be afraid to ask questions about their pricing and any extra costs that may apply.
By performing the time to investigate your options and be aware of the factors that affect rental costs, you can obtain the best possible deal for your undertaking.

Obtain a Roll Off Dumpster at Your Project
Utilizing a roll off dumpster can drastically simplify your waste disposal endeavors. Here are some crucial tips to ensure a smooth and successful experience. Firstly, meticulously calculate the appropriate dumpster size according to your project's volume. Oversizing can be expensive, while undersizing can result in hassle.
- Prioritize the dumpster is positioned on a level surface to prevent sinking or damage. Clear any obstacles nearby the delivery area for safe and efficient access.
- Refrain from overloading the dumpster past threshold. Distribute the waste evenly to maintain balance and prevent tipping.
- Sort your waste appropriately for recycling or disposal. Adhere local regulations regarding banned items, such as paints, batteries, and hazardous materials.
- Communicate your rental company as soon as possible if you encounter any issues or require assistance.
Safety First: Handling Roll Off Dumpsters Properly securely
When using roll off dumpsters, prioritizing safety is paramount. These large containers can be risky if not handled properly. Always check the dumpster before loading it to ensure it's in good condition and stable. Avoid overloading the dumpster, as this can cause it to become tippy. Never climb on or inside the dumpster, as this can lead to serious injuries. When unloading materials from the dumpster, be conscious of your surroundings and use caution when lifting heavy objects.
- Wear appropriate gear, such as gloves and sturdy footwear.
- Ensure the dumpster is placed on a level surface to prevent tipping.
- Arrange with the dumpster rental company for safe pickup and disposal.
Roll Off Dumpster's Effect on the Environment
Roll off dumpsters are an essential part of many construction and renovation projects. While they offer aconvenient way to dispose large amounts of waste, their influence on the environment shouldn't be dismissed. The manufacture and transport of these dumpsters themselves utilize resources and generate greenhouse gases. Additionally, the debris collected in roll off dumpsters often ends up in landfills, where it increases methane emissions, a potent greenhouse gas.
- Encouraging recycling and waste reduction at the source is a crucial step in reducing the environmental impact of roll off dumpsters.
- Selecting dumpster companies that prioritize sustainable practices, such as using fuel-efficient vehicles or partnering with local recycling facilities, can make a positive change.
- Increasing awareness among businesses about the environmental consequences of waste disposal can lead to more responsible practices.
